I've seen this discussion many times in my life and always chuckle when people worry they are not loosing lbs over inches. Any loss in inches is a loss right? I guess it's my turn to be that person. I am on day 11 of the 21 day fix. I am 5"3 and when I started was 149. My weight since then fluctuates between 147.2 and 148.8- so no significant weight loss as of yet. I had lost over 3 inches through out my body (as of Sunday). I know that I am creating muscle (it is obvious) but when do you think the scale will catch up with what I am doing? Every time I have worked out I loose weight quickly along with gaining muscle, but this routine has thrown me off since I am gaining muscle first. I guess. My expectation has always been to see the scale change WITH the muscle gain. Any words of wisdom? I guess I am just trying not to get down with the scale not moving. I love my body for what it is doing- I don't like how my fear of the number is blocking me from seeing the great thing I am doing. Thanks in advance!

    Words of wisdom would be to focus on your measurements and how your clothes fit vs the scale. Often when we lose fat and put on muscle, the scale only moves a bit or not at all.

    I know its difficult to visualize it - I struggle with it all the time but that's pretty much the truth. When I was at my fittest like my avatar, I weighed 165lbs I believe. Weight means nothing.

    It is SUPER hard to see the scale not showing any progress, believe me, I know! My weight has fluctuated within a 10 lb range for most of the last 2 years. That being said, in the last 3 years, I have gone from a size 18 pants/42DD bra to a size 10/12 pants and a 38DD bra.

    10 years ago I was 175 lbs and a size 16...today I am 192 lbs and a size 10. Yep, I weigh almost 20 lbs more, but I'm several sizes smaller!
